>웹 프론트엔드 >프런트엔드 Q&A >jquery에서 콜론은 무엇을 의미합니까?

jquery에서 콜론은 무엇을 의미합니까?

PHPz
PHPz원래의
2023-05-18 21:07:08734검색

jQuery는 HTML 문서 작업, 이벤트 처리, 애니메이션 효과, Ajax 상호 작용 등에 일반적으로 사용되는 JavaScript 라이브러리입니다. jQuery에서 콜론은 다양한 용도로 사용되는 매우 중요한 기호입니다. Jquery에서 콜론의 일반적인 의미를 몇 가지 소개하겠습니다.

  1. Selector

jQuery에서 선택기는 DOM 트리의 특정 요소를 선택할 수 있습니다. 콜론은 선택자에서 자주 사용되는 기호입니다. 예를 들어, ":even" 선택기를 사용하면 HTML 문서에서 모든 짝수 요소를 선택할 수 있습니다.

$("tr:even")

이 코드는 HTML 문서에서 모든 짝수 a34de1251f0d9fe1e645927f19a896e8 요소를 선택한다는 뜻입니다. 마찬가지로 ":odd"를 사용하여 홀수 위치에 있는 요소를 선택할 수도 있습니다.

"짝수"와 "홀수" 외에도 jQuery는 ":first", ":last", ":nth-child" 등과 같은 다른 많은 선택자를 제공합니다. 이 모두는 우리가 더 나은 결과를 얻을 수 있도록 도와줍니다. 구체적이고 필요한 요소를 빠르고 쉽게 선택하세요.

  1. 의사 클래스

CSS에서 의사 클래스는 특정 상태의 요소 스타일을 나타냅니다. jQuery에는 특정 상태의 요소를 선택하거나 조작하는 데 도움이 되는 몇 가지 특정 의사 클래스도 있습니다. 예를 들어, ":hover"는 마우스가 요소 위에 있을 때의 상태를 나타냅니다. 이를 사용하여 마우스 호버 이벤트를 바인딩할 수 있습니다.

$("button:hover").css("background-color", "red");

이 코드는 마우스가 bb9345e55eb71822850ff156dfde57c8 요소 위에 있을 때를 나타냅니다. 배경색이 빨간색입니다.

":hover" 외에도 jQuery에서 지원하는 다른 의사 클래스에는 ":focus", ":active", ":checked" 등이 있습니다. 이러한 의사 클래스는 다양한 상태의 요소 표시 효과를 더 잘 처리하는 데 도움이 될 수 있습니다.

  1. 의사 요소

HTML 문서에는 :before, :after 및 기타 의사 요소와 같이 DOM 트리에 존재하지 않는 일부 요소가 있습니다. jQuery에서는 요소를 조작하기 위해 의사 요소도 지원됩니다.

예를 들어 ":before"를 사용하면 요소 앞에 콘텐츠나 스타일을 추가할 수 있습니다.

$("p:before").css("content", "hello");

이 코드는 모든 e388a4556c0f65e1904146cc1a846bee 요소 앞에 "hello" 텍스트를 추가하는 것을 의미합니다. 마찬가지로 ":after"와 ":before"도 매우 유사하게 사용됩니다.

요약

jQuery에서 콜론은 다양한 용도로 사용되는 매우 중요한 기호입니다. 위에서 소개한 선택자, 의사 클래스, 의사 요소 외에도 ":input", ":password" 등과 같은 특정 콜론 사용법이 많이 있습니다. 이러한 콜론을 능숙하게 사용하면 HTML 문서의 요소를 보다 편리하고 빠르게 조작하는 데 도움이 될 수 있습니다.

위 내용은 jquery에서 콜론은 무엇을 의미합니까?의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

성명:
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.